1. Selecting the Right Email Template

Your email template is the canvas for your message. It's not just about looks; it's about functionality and brand alignment. The right template makes it easier for you to create compelling content consistently and ensures your messages look great on any device.

  • Ease and Efficiency: Choose a template that's simple yet adaptable, one that reflects your brand's aesthetic while being easy to update with new content like images or text.
  • Consistency is Key: A good template should facilitate consistency in your communication, making it easy to create and send emails without needing extensive design resources.
  • Pro Tip: Think of your template as a guide that ensures each email is a balance of brand consistency and fresh content. An effective template is one you can rely on repeatedly, saving you time and effort.

2. Providing Value Beyond Products

Email marketing isn't just about selling; it's about building a relationship with your audience. By providing content that adds value beyond just your products or services, you're engaging your audience with your brand's lifestyle and ethos, deepening their connection to your business.

  • Content That Connects: Focus on creating content that aligns with your brand's lifestyle and values, offering more than just product promotions. Share stories, insights, and information that your audience finds useful or entertaining.
  • Inspiration and Aspiration: Look to brands that excel in integrating their products into a broader narrative. For example, examine how brands like Yeti communicate their lifestyle through their content.
  • Pro Tip: Use content to showcase the lifestyle associated with your brand. This approach helps in building a deeper connection with your audience, positioning your brand as a part of their everyday lives.

3. Establishing a Consistent Email Schedule

Consistency is the key to keeping your audience engaged and building trust. Establishing a regular email schedule helps your subscribers know when to expect to hear from you, creating anticipation and maintaining a steady flow of communication.

  • Building a Routine: Develop a consistent schedule for your emails, whether it's we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ly. Consistency helps keep your audience engaged and your brand top-of-mind.
  • Planning Ahead: Utilize a content calendar to plan out your email topics, ensuring a well-organized approach to your email marketing strategy.
  • Pro Tip: Aim for a minimum of one email per month. Regular communication is crucial for maintaining a connection with your subscribers and keeping them informed about your brand.
